Please excuse what might be seen as shameless self-promotion, but I am aware
that many on this list live where it is prohibitively expensive to set up a
lab of any sort. Further, I'm aware that there is an increasing interest in
and demand for access to modern biotechnology for smaller project groups and
individuals, for whom the costs of setup are again prohibitive.

So without wasting time, I'd like to introduce Dremelfuge, a design I made
to help remedy this need:
